
When considering purchasing electronics or tech products online, one common concern among buyers is whether the retailer provides insurance or protection for their packages during transit. Newegg, a popular online marketplace for computer hardware, software, and other tech-related items, does offer certain safeguards to ensure customer satisfaction. While Newegg itself does not directly insure packages, it partners with shipping carriers that provide basic liability coverage for lost or damaged items. Additionally, Newegg offers optional shipping insurance during checkout, which customers can purchase for added protection. This insurance typically covers the full value of the item in case of damage, loss, or theft during shipping. Buyers are encouraged to review their shipping options and consider the additional insurance, especially for high-value purchases, to ensure peace of mind and financial protection.

Claim Process: Steps to file a claim for damaged or lost packages from Newegg
When dealing with damaged or lost packages from Newegg, understanding the claim process is essential to ensure a smooth resolution. Newegg does offer insurance for packages, and their customer service team is equipped to handle claims efficiently. To initiate the claim process, start by gathering all necessary information, including your order number, tracking details, and any relevant photos of the damaged items or packaging. This preparation will streamline the process and help Newegg assess your claim promptly.
The first step in filing a claim is to contact Newegg’s customer service team. You can do this through their website by logging into your account and navigating to the customer service or support section. Alternatively, you can call their customer service hotline or use their live chat feature if available. When reaching out, clearly state that you are filing a claim for a damaged or lost package and provide your order details. Newegg’s representatives will guide you through the initial steps and may ask for additional information to verify your claim.
Once your claim is initiated, Newegg will investigate the issue. For damaged items, they may request photos of the product and its packaging to assess the extent of the damage. If the package is lost, they will likely coordinate with the shipping carrier to track the shipment. During this stage, it’s important to respond promptly to any requests for information from Newegg to avoid delays. The investigation process can take a few days to a week, depending on the complexity of the case.
After the investigation, Newegg will determine the appropriate resolution for your claim. This could include a refund, replacement of the item, or compensation for the damage or loss. If your claim is approved, Newegg will inform you of the next steps, such as arranging for a replacement shipment or processing a refund to your original payment method. In some cases, they may offer store credit or a discount on a future purchase as a goodwill gesture.

Third-Party Insurance: Can customers use external insurance providers for Newegg shipments?
When considering the safety of shipments from Newegg, many customers wonder if they can use third-party insurance providers to protect their purchases. Newegg, as a leading online retailer of tech and electronics, offers its own shipping insurance options, but the question remains: Can customers use external insurance providers for Newegg shipments? The short answer is yes, customers can explore third-party insurance options, but there are important factors to consider before doing so.
Newegg provides built-in shipping insurance for certain orders, particularly those involving high-value items or premium shipping methods. This coverage typically protects against loss, theft, or damage during transit. However, the extent of this insurance varies depending on the shipping method chosen and the specific item being shipped. For instance, Newegg’s standard shipping may include minimal coverage, while expedited or premium shipping options often come with more comprehensive protection. Customers should review Newegg’s shipping policies or contact customer support to understand the exact coverage provided for their order.
If customers feel that Newegg’s built-in insurance is insufficient or if they prefer additional peace of mind, they can opt for third-party insurance providers. External insurance companies, such as Shipsurance or InsureShip, offer customizable coverage plans tailored to the value of the shipment. To use third-party insurance, customers must first ensure that Newegg’s terms and conditions do not explicitly prohibit external coverage. While Newegg does not typically restrict the use of third-party insurance, it’s essential to verify this to avoid complications in case of a claim.
When purchasing third-party insurance, customers should provide accurate details about the shipment, including the item’s value, destination, and shipping method. The external insurer will then issue a policy that covers the package during transit. In the event of loss, damage, or theft, the customer would file a claim directly with the third-party insurer, not with Newegg.
